IEaxGrid.HierarchicalIndent

Синтаксис

HierarchicalIndent(Kind: EaxHierarchyKind): Double;

Параметры

Kind. Объект (строка или столбец), по которому необходимо установить интервал отступа в раскрывающейся иерархии.

Описание

Свойство HierarchicalIndent определяет интервал отступа элементов различных уровней раскрывающейся иерархии в таблице экспресс-отчета.

Комментарии

По умолчанию устанавливается отступ - 5 мм.

Пример

Sub Main;

Var

MB: IMetabase;

MObj: IMetabaseObject;

Expr: IEaxAnalyzer;

Grid: IEaxGrid;

Begin

MB := MetabaseClass.Active;

MObj := MB.ItemById("EXPRESS_REPORT").Edit;

Expr := MObj As IEaxAnalyzer;

Grid := Expr.Grid;

Grid.Hierarchical(EaxHierarchyKind.Rows) := True;

Grid.HierarchicalIndent(EaxHierarchyKind.Rows) := 10;

MObj.Save

End Sub Main;

После выполнения примера будет включена раскрывающаяся иерархия по строкам таблицы. Интервал отступа между элементами различных уровней будет установлен - 10. Идентификатор экспресс-отчета - «EXPRESS_REPORT».

См. также:

IEaxGrid